In everyday usage, 'weight' refers to how heavy an object is — typically measured in kilograms (kg), pounds (lb), or grams (g). In physics, weight is a force (W = mg, where m is mass and g is gravitational acceleration ≈ 9.8 m/s²), measured in Newtons. For most scientific and medical purposes, mass (kg) is the more precise term. Body weight is a central clinical and physiological measurement used to calculate drug doses, BMI, caloric needs, fluid requirements, and ideal body weight. Unit conversions between kg, lb, g, and oz are among the most common calculations in everyday life.

Weight vs. Mass

Mass (kg): the amount of matter in an object — constant regardless of location. Weight (N): the gravitational force on an object — W = m × g. On Earth's surface, g ≈ 9.81 m/s². A 70 kg person weighs 70 × 9.81 = 686.7 N on Earth. On the Moon (g = 1.62 m/s²), the same person weighs 70 × 1.62 = 113 N — but mass is still 70 kg.

Common Unit Conversions

  • 1 kg = 2.2046 lb
  • 1 lb = 0.4536 kg
  • 1 kg = 1000 g
  • 1 oz = 28.35 g
  • 1 lb = 16 oz = 453.6 g
  • 1 stone (UK) = 14 lb = 6.35 kg

Ideal Body Weight Formulas

Devine formula: Men: IBW = 50 + 2.3 × (inches over 5 ft). Women: IBW = 45.5 + 2.3 × (inches over 5 ft). Units: kg. Used for drug dosing, ventilator settings, and nutritional assessment.

BMI and Weight

BMI = weight (kg) / height² (m). Normal: 18.5–24.9; overweight: 25–29.9; obese: ≥ 30. BMI uses mass, not weight (Newtons). On food labels, 'calories per serving' depend on serving mass (grams).

Glossary

Mass vs. Weight
Mass (kg) = amount of matter, constant everywhere; weight (N) = gravitational force = m × g; everyday scales report mass; in science, use mass; in medicine, weight means mass in kg.
Ideal Body Weight (IBW)
Estimated optimal weight for height: men = 50 + 2.3×(inches above 5 ft); women = 45.5 + 2.3×(inches above 5 ft), in kg; used for drug dosing adjustments in pharmacology.
Adjusted Body Weight (ABW)
ABW = IBW + 0.4×(actual−IBW); used for weight-based dosing of drugs in obese patients where actual weight overestimates distribution volume; intermediate between IBW and actual weight.

Frequently Asked Questions

Mass (measured in kg) is the amount of matter — constant everywhere. Weight (measured in Newtons or pounds-force) is the gravitational force on an object: W = mg. On Earth (g = 9.81 m/s²), a 70 kg person 'weighs' 686 N. In everyday life, scales report mass in kg or lb, not true weight in Newtons. On the Moon, a person's mass is unchanged (70 kg) but their weight is only ~113 N (1/6 of Earth). In science: use mass (kg); in medicine and everyday language, 'weight' means mass as measured on a scale.

1 kg = 2.2046 lb; 1 lb = 0.4536 kg. To convert kg to lb: multiply by 2.2046. Example: 80 kg × 2.2046 = 176.4 lb. To convert lb to kg: divide by 2.2046 (or multiply by 0.4536). Example: 150 lb × 0.4536 = 68.0 kg. Quick approximation: kg × 2.2 ≈ lb; lb / 2.2 ≈ kg. This is important in medicine where drug doses in mg/kg require the weight in kg — always convert lb to kg before dose calculation.

Ideal body weight estimates optimal weight for a given height. Devine formula: men = 50 + 2.3 × (inches above 5 feet); women = 45.5 + 2.3 × (inches above 5 feet), in kg. Example: 5'10" (10 inches above 5 ft) male: IBW = 50 + 2.3×10 = 73 kg. IBW is used in clinical pharmacology for dosing drugs whose distribution correlates better with lean body mass than actual body weight (aminoglycosides, certain chemotherapy agents). Adjusted body weight (ABW = IBW + 0.4×(actual − IBW)) is used when actual weight significantly exceeds IBW.

Most drug doses are calculated per kg of body weight: total dose = weight (kg) × dose rate (mg/kg). Always use the patient's actual weight unless dosing guidelines specify IBW or ABW. Convert lb to kg: divide by 2.2. Example: prescribe amoxicillin 25 mg/kg to a 44 lb child: weight = 44/2.2 = 20 kg; dose = 25 × 20 = 500 mg. For obese patients, using actual weight for certain drugs (aminoglycosides, vancomycin, some chemotherapy) can cause overdosing and toxicity — always check dosing guidelines for weight adjustment recommendations.
